    Description

    Position Title:

    Business Systems Analyst Team Lead

    Job Description:

    The Business Systems Team Lead works with Finance Director and Business Systems Analysts to develop and administrate business solutions for the divisions within the Finance Department. Incumbent works directly with the operations teams providing system administration, technical support, business analysis, and reporting. Provides analysis in technology, management issues, communications, equipment evaluation and procurement, and other areas as required. Serves as project manager and liaison between IMS Division staff, project vendors, and personnel in the city departments. Supports the assigned work groups by analyzing business system needs, mobile communications and applications, and participates in department procedures and policy implementations. Serves in a "Train the Trainer" role supporting learning and consistent business uses of service applications. Supports website content management.

    TYPICAL DUTIES:

  • Serves in a team leadership role for the department's Business Systems Analysts. Serves in a lead project management role for significant division or department wide service projects.
  • Meets regularly with program and division directors, department management, and IMS management to coordinate department technology projects, goals, and implementations.
  • Manages and serves as department/division administrator for other department-wide systems and other software systems that serve the department. Troubleshoots, configures and coordinates support and new implementations.
  • Manages and serves as a division administrator for work group systems. Including Asset and Inventory Management, Service Requests, Workday ERP system, etc.
  • Monitors, administers and supports software and computer systems that provide essential business functions specific to the division/department, to ensure functionality, reliability and ongoing improvement of those systems. Works with Information Management Services (IMS) in advising, servicing and identifying needs of the staff.
  • Serves as department/division mobile device administrator. Works with vendors and employees to facilitate contract negotiations, repair, and replacement of phones and other mobile devices. Recommends mobile solutions to department.
  • Serves as department/division Webmaster. Reviews content, recommends changes, publishes updates and otherwise looks to improve department website.
  • Conducts cost/benefit analysis, statistical analysis, and other measures to support management decisions. Evaluates technology needs and makes recommendations to department administration. Assists when necessary in the preparation of divisional budgets.
  • Prepares or assists in preparation of management reports related to the department.
  • Manages configuration, security, reporting, and business processed in the Workday ERP system.
  • Assists in compiling and communicating both orally and in writing, internal and external information on department programs as needed.
  • Performs other related duties as required to meet customer expectations.
  • DESIRED QUALIFICATIONS:

  • Knowledge of Workday FINS and Payroll systems including configuration, report writing, security, and business process management. Knowledge of Kyriba and Salesforce.
  • Knowledge of computer hardware and similar device setups.
  • Knowledge of ERP, Payroll, and related financial systems including configuration, security, and reporting
  • MINIMUM QUALIFICATIONS:

  • Graduation from an accredited college or university with a bachelor's degree in Business Management, Management Information Systems or related field, plus five to seven years of related work experience including large project management experience. Up to four years of directly related work experience may be substituted for required education on a year-for-year basis.
  • Ability to communicate both orally and in writing, highly technical ideas in clear, concise terminology that is understandable to non-computer oriented committees, departmental users as well as to IMS professional staff.
  • Demonstrable experience in project management.
  • Ability to be a resource in solving very complex technical problems, training and mentoring others, and initiating changes to processes and procedures to meet ongoing user needs.
  • Knowledge of computer hardware setups, mobile communication devices and their setups.
  • Knowledge of asset management systems including preventive maintenance work orders scheduling, condition assessment tracking, work load balancing, equipment tasks, web based work orders implementation and processes, system tracking of equipment and inventory.
  • Possession of a valid state driver license or Utah identification card may be required.
  • WORKING CONDITIONS

  • Light physical effort. Intermittent sitting, standing & walking. Comfortable working conditions.
  • Regular exposure to stressful situations as a result of human behavior and the demands of the position.
